What you write about SP (and BB) can be true due to field dimensions and position of fielders. My comments were more towards FP, although still apply well to SP.

Think about your swing with what you are saying. To impart that much "english" on the ball, you are not stopping the bat. You are slicing all the way through.

Stopping your swing is risky business too as it gets closer to violating SP hitting rules. Stopping your bat provides the PU the opportunity to judge whether you have bunted or not.
